How Much Does Cape Cod Disposal Pay for employees?

As of May 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Cape Cod Disposal in the United States is $102,485.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$49. Salaries at Cape Cod Disposal typically range from $90,336 to $115,753 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company. Cape Cod Disposal’s salaries are influenced by a wide range of factors including job role, department, years of experience, and location.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Boston?

Understanding the cost of living near Boston is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Cape Cod Disposal.
Boston's Cost of Living Index is approximately 153.2 (53.2% more expensive than US average; 15.5% more than MA average). Major historic US city, world-class universities/hospitals, extremely high housing costs, extensive MBTA transit. When planning your budget based on a salary from Cape Cod Disposal,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$2,500 - $3,800+ A significant portion of Cape Cod Disposal sal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$180 - $290 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$90 (MBTA LinkPass monthly)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$500 - $750 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$550 - $1,000+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$450 - $850+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$4,270 - $6,690+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
